More about this session
Success is in love with preparation, are you well prepared?
One of preparation’s elements is your communication with all its verbal and non-verbal pillars so that when you talk people listen, understand and take necessary action towards the solution(s) you are offering.
So, while you are talking, what does your body say? Do you trust a person affirming a statement in words while shaking his head sideways? If not, why is that so?
It’s important to know that we can’t understand all of our subconscious processes underneath the logical realm but we have the chance to get a glimpse of what’s happening through its bodily manifestations to decipher its dimensions to the extent our imperfect brains allow us to stretch and reach!
Wisdom is the application of knowledge!
We’re having an emotional experience while communicating, so you might want to develop your emotional recognition muscles, get to understand your and others’ personality traits, and acquire the skill of communicating sagely with them aiming to build and sustain more authentic relationships while becoming the role model you would like yourself to embody with all the qualities, values and virtues that character holds.
In this session, Mr. Choufany will highlight few body language concepts and extract the practical lessons they provide which will enable you to become a bit more aware consequently a bit more successful.
- 5 Functions of Body Language
- 4 Body Language Criteria for Accurate Interpretations
- 4 basic modes of Body Language
- 5 Types of Body Language Gestures
- The 6 Pillars of Silence
- High Power Body Language Code

How to Be Mentally Stronger, Happier, and Resilient is a series of webinars on mental health held by the Counseling Service at Antonine University (UA), where professional speakers, psychologists, life coaches, and doctors, will be discussing and spreading awareness on several issues. This program was launched during the academic year 2020-2021 and was open to UA students, and in view of its success, the second edition will be open to public. A new theme will be tackled each month during which interesting weekly topics will be addressed. The participant who attends all the weekly topics of a monthly theme will get an electronic certificate of participation.
